Scholarship Benefits:

The Otago International Pathway Scholarship provides an NZD$3,000 contribution towards the tuition fee for all students enrolling in the Foundation Studies Certificate.

Eligibility Criteria:

Students must meet the following requirements:

  1. International students who are not citizens, permanent residents or resident visa holders of New Zealand or Australia*; and
  2. Have gained admission to the Foundation Studies Certificate through meeting both academic and English entry requirements, as outlined on the Otago website, and
  3. Are subject to paying international tuition fees; and
  4. Are enrolling in the Foundation Studies Certificate for the first time.

Eligible Program:

This scholarship applies to the Foundation Studies Certificate, offered either on campus or online for students outside of New Zealand.
